Transaction 7c53a05e48b3bc24911f7cac13a685a0a04aaf91735d8ea2ec865700da043261
1 Input
1 Output
-
7c53a05e48b3bc24911f7cac13a685a0a04aaf91735d8ea2ec865700da043261:0
- value
- 166027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d66bd7e30ac6f960bd65b73a5d4e4005e4835a56 OP_EQUAL
- address
- 3MEmigPMYafBxDSbPzHWdNW3nm7MUhZwqU